  • L’histoire du soldat (Episode 6 of 33)

    The second part of an evening devoted to performance of works by Igor Stravinsky (1882-1971) held at WBAI’s Free Music Store on December 18, 1971. This part contains a performance of Stravinsky’s theatrical work L’Histoire du Soldat (The Soldier’s Tale) (1918).
